What Is Batana Oil and Its Origins?
Extracted from the native Batana plant growing in Honduras, Batana Oil holds a storied history rooted in indigenous traditions. The oil is obtained through traditional cold-pressing methods that preserve its potent nutrients. Known locally as "La Pousse des Cheveux," Batana Oil has been used for centuries to nurture hair and scalp health.
The key to its effectiveness lies in its rich composition of beneficial ingredients, including essential fatty acids (like oleic and linoleic acids), antioxidants, vitamins A and E, and proteins that deeply nourish hair strands and scalp tissues alike.

Understanding Hair Growth Cycles and How Batana Oil Helps
Hair growth occurs in cycles, including the anagen (growth), catagen (transition), and telogen (rest) phases. Factors like hormonal imbalances, stress, and scalp conditions can disturb this cycle. Batana Oil’s nourishing and healing properties help maintain a healthy environment for each phase, promoting stronger, thicker hair.
